AZ HIMSS Education Series - Utilizing Analytics to influence Population Care
Topics: Predictive and Prescriptive Analytics
Abstract: Across the industry we are seeing more organizations utilizing information they have harvested in the last 10 years in their EHRs in order to provide preventative or prescriptive care. In this webinar we will explore different approaches to predictive analytics and practical learnings that have been realized through recent advances in this application. We will also discuss cost benefits that are associated with application of preventative measures obtained through this analysis.

Linda Buscemi
Chief Financial Officer
Taproot Interventions & Solutions
Linda is the Co-Founder & Chief Clinical Officer of TapRoot Interventions & Solutions. She has 25+ years across the healthcare industry as a clinical therapist and behavioral expert. Before her own start up, Linda developed the behavior change program to complement a wellness program for Bank of America contract. The outcomes of the program and notably the behavioral change program was sighted as a key driver of the acquisition to AllScripts which sold as a bundled package for ~$200M. As a follow-up, Linda created content and was the subject-matter expert for peer-to-peer empathy digital platform, LifeGuides™.
Her career experience includes executive leadership, direct services, and since 2006, Linda has focused her career in the long-term area, specifically in Alzheimer’s and dementia patients. Her unique approach provides effective interventions enabling positive impact on the measures of the frequency of behavior, psychotropic medications, and hospitalizations while limiting the use of psychotropic medication. Linda’s career supports her philosophy which encompasses prevention and reduction of behaviors.
Linda has several publications since her first research paper with the CDC and Emory University in 1996 to her latest publication of her first book which was an Amazon best seller.
Dr. Matthias Kochmann
Sutter Health
Dr. Kochmann is board certified Pediatrician and Clinical Informatician. He works for Sutter Health in the Bay Area in the Pediatric Urgent Care Center and is part of their Clinical Informatics Team. Dr. Kochmann founded his own consulting company that supports healthcare IT startups with R&D, Customer Success, and Healthcare System Integration. In addition, he established a non-profit that provides sexual health education to schools.
Dr. Kochmann got his medical degree from Semmelweis University in Budapest, Hungary. He completed his pediatric residency at Children's Hospital at SUNY Downstate in Brooklyn, NY, and his clinical informatics fellowship at the Regenstrief Institute/ Indiana University in Indianapolis, IN. Dr. Kochmann has a Master's in Biomedical Informatics from Oregon Health and Science University.
Yukon Chen
VP Artificial Intelligence
Pieces, Inc.
Yukun Chen, PhD, is the Vice President of Artificial Intelligence (AI) who oversees a team of applied scientists in data science and natural language processing (NLP), data analysts, and data engineers to develop and deliver healthcare AI and analytics solutions. He has been one of the original members at Pieces since early 2016.
Prior to Pieces, Dr. Chen was an NLP scientist at PCCI, a visiting scholar in University of Texas Health Science Center at Houston, an intern at MD Anderson Cancer Center, and a health system software engineer at Vanderbilt University Medical Center.
Dr. Chen’s research has focused on medical NLP, interactive machine learning, deep learning, and biomedical informatics. He has published over 20 peer-reviewed papers in several high-impact journals and conferences in the health informatics domain including Nature methods, JAMIA, AMIA, and JBI among others.
Dr. Chen received his PhD in biomedical informatics from Vanderbilt University in 2015, and MSE in Electrical Engineering from University of Pennsylvania in 2008.
